Minnesota Vikings vs. Chicago Bears Gambling Prediction & Week 2 Preview

Minnesota vs Chicago NFL Football Spread/Handicapping

Minnesota is on the road for yet another divisional game. Last week they lost at Detroit and a loss this week would be especially damaging because it would drop them to 0-2 and two games behind at least Chicago in the NFC North.

On the other hand Chicago was very solid in beating a good Cincinnati team in their opener (a game it looked like they would lose through most of). They are at home again and looking to get back to winning against Minnesota, a team they had beaten 6 times in a row before losing to them down the stretch of last season as part of their collapse.

Its early in the season but revenge is revenge especially for these teams which have a lot of the same core players.

Minnesota

Minnesota has to rebound from last week’s loss to Detroit in a hurry. The game was kind of an epic fail all the way around with the defense giving up 34 points, QB Christian Ponder throwing three interceptions and even though RB Adrian Peterson rushed for 98 yards, 78 of those came on one play which means the Lions really shut him down other than that.

Last year when they beat the Bears it was like a lot of victories for Minnesota in the sense that they ran Peterson to the tune of 150+ yards and hoped for the best.

That is the kind of thing that might work at home but on the road they are going to need Ponder to help win the game not just avoid losing it. The brightest spot from last week was WR Jerome Simpson who caught balls for 140 yards. Nobody else topped 33 though making it pretty obvious who the defense was concerned about.

Chicago

The Bengals beating the Bears was an upset I was sure of coming into Sunday so kudos to Chicago for proving me wrong. In watching the game they didn’t do anything all that special. They ran the ball a bit, threw the ball the WR Brandon Marshall and caused some turnovers.

In fact it looked so familiar you wouldn’t even have noticed a new coach on the sidelines.

That might be a problem for the Bears at some point but probably not yet against a very familiar opponent that they have beaten up over the years. As much as any team the Bears know how to beat the Vikings – contain Peterson and make Ponder work to beat you.

It worked at home last year when they bottled him up for just over 100 yards forcing Ponder to throw more than 40 times.

When that happens Minnesota is not going to be very successful, especially against a team like the Bears which is so good at forcing turnovers.

Spread Pick: Chicago -5.5
O/U Pick: Under
Score Prediction: Chicago 24 – Minnesota 14
